The scope of legal protection for listed buildings
This List entry helps identify the building designated at this address for its special architectural or historic interest.
Unless the List entry states otherwise, it includes both the structure itself and any object or structure fixed to it (whether inside or outside) as well as any object or structure within the curtilage of the building.
For these purposes, to be included within the curtilage of the building, the object or structure must have formed part of the land since before 1st July 1948.

Details
SLAPTON START SX84SW Deerbridge Mill House 8/122 including front garden area wall
GV II
Miller's house. Circa early C19. Dressed slate rubble. Asbestos slate roof with gabled ends. Rendered gable end stacks, the left stack has tall shaft and both have louvred clay pots. Plan: Double dept plan with 2 principal front rooms and entrance between. The back rooms are probably service rooms. On the left side an integral watermill (qv). Exterior: 2 storeys. Almost symmetrical 3-window west front 12-pane sashes, the first floor centre left hand window have been replaced by 16- pane sashes and the ground floor has 2-light 12-pane sashes. Central doorway with C19 fielded 6-panel door, the top panels glazed and C20 wooden open porch. On right hand end C20 casements. Including front garden area wall; Cl9 slate rubble with rounded corners and gateway at the centre. Interior not inspected but might retain some original joinery including doors, chimneypieces and staircase etc.
